Game Preview: IPFW

The Crusaders finish up a three game road trip with a visit to Fort Wayne in a contest against the IPFW Mastodons.  If you go back to our preseason predictions both Brent and I predict a Valpo Victory in this one.  Valpo is coming off an exciting team win in their conference opener at Butler on Saturday while the Mastodons will try to build off their victory at home over South Dakota.

The Opposition
The IPFW Mastodons are 3-3 on the year with victories over Judson, Nebraska Omaha, and South Dakota.  Their losses have come at the hands of a highly ranked Xavier team, at Iowa, and at home to UMKC.  The Mastodons are led by Frank Gaines and Trey McCorkle.  Gaines is the leading scorer averaging over 23 points per game, is a threat from the outside (10-31), and a turnover waiting to happen (18 on the year).  McCorkle is averaging a respectable 13.5 points per game and nearly 8 rebounds.  IPFW is not a real good shooting team (just over 30% from outside and 44% overall) but they appear to be a decent rebounding squad (outrebounding their opponents by an average of 9 per game).

Keys to a Valpo Victory
* Rebound on the defensive end.  The 22 offensive rebounds surrendered against Butler is unacceptable.  Valpo won't win if they don't fix this.
* Valpo needs to continue to attack the rim and pound the ball inside.  They have great success doing this all year.  I would like to see the ball come back out once in a while, but I can't argue with the results so far.
* Valpo can't look ahead to Saturday's game with Bowling Green.  If they can keep their focus on IPFW this should be a victory.
